    Interest in a 2016 Meet Up

    I've been thinking over this idea of something after reading about interest in a prepper fair down south. I wanted to see if there'd be any interest in it from folks in my region, be it PA or other areas like NY, MD, WV etc from where people would be willing to drive in from. My idea would be to set up a meet for sometime next year if there is interest. Just an informal prepper/ survival meet and greet weekend sometime in 2016, likely somewhere in central PA, most likely at a state park or similar.

    I'm envisioning a family friendly affair to get people together to meet face to face and for people to have fun in the outdoors. Idea would be to have it at a site with both tent and trailer camping site available yet hopefully close enough to hotel/ motels for those new to things who might not have gear or for those who might not be looking to "rough it".

    Aim would be to get to know one another and network real time, do some things like skill developments and fun skill challenges. Maybe even with some small prizes if we could raise some funds or get some donations. Maybe do some skill workshops to cover skills for newbies, kids or those that might just be rusty. Then have some sort of challenge to test what they just learned individual and random teams. Like say fire starting races, knot and lashing challenges, plant identification, cooking competition, etc...just a few of the types of topics I was thinking. This would be similar events testing outdoor skills and knowledge I recall doing as a boy in Scouts. Maybe some short hikes to cover basics of hiking along with function stacking in things like identifying plants and trees. Maybe demonstrate or discuss skills like water purification, trapping/ snarring, etc... you get the general idea. Maybe survey those interested and see what topics they'd be interested in. Maybe even try to find some vendor types, say a knife maker willing to show their skills and process and also allow them to have products available or to be able to connect with this group as possible future customers.

    Nothing to fancy or overly complex or schedule heavy. Would want to allow lots of time to network and allow spending time together with each others families.

    Might be a pipe dream or not get people to show. One thing for people to say yes, another for them to actually show. Might prove to much to try to put together but thought I'd start to test the waters.
